Brief Summary
The purpose of this 2-site (CT, AL) study is to test innovative interventions to reduce stigma and improve the pre-exposure prophylaxis (PrEP) and opioid use disorder (OUD) care continua in women involved in the criminal justice system (WICJ). This study evaluates a newly validated PrEP decision aid and eHealth for integrated PrEP and MOUD compared to a decision aid-only for WICJ with OUD.
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ion Criteria: * woman * have access to a working mobile or landline phone * Lifetime CJ-involvement (probation, parole, intensive pretrial or community supervision, or release from prison/jail) * are confirmed HIV-negative by point-of-care 3rd generation HIV antibody test * meet clinical criteria for PrEP * have opioid use disorder (regardless of baseline treatment status) Exclusion Criteria: * unable or unwilling to provide informed consent * pregnant or breast-feeding * currently taking PrEP at the time of study enrollment * not comfortable conversing in English or Spanish.
